According to stopcov.ge, as part of the intensive testing, 25,745 tests were conducted across the country in the last 24 hours, including 15,240 antigen tests and 10,505 PCR tests.
Testing revealed 2,953 new cases of the virus in the last 24 hours. The total number of confirmed cases detected to date since the outbreak of the Covid-19 pandemic in the country amounts to 962,827.
As of January 9, the daily positive rate is 11.47%, for the last 14 days - 7.76% and for 7 days - 9.57%.
In the last 24 hours, 1,085 people recovered from the virus, bringing the total to 913,528. 31 deaths from coronavirus were reported in the last 24 hours. A total of 14,218 people have died from the virus since the pandemic spread.
Out of 2,953 new cases of infection detected in the country today: 1,925 cases were reported in Tbilisi, Adjara - 336, Imereti - 218, Kvemo Kartli - 80, Shida Kartli - 65, Guria - 77, Samegrelo - Zemo Svaneti - 126, Kakheti - 63, Mtskheta - Mtianeti -26, Samtskhe-Javakheti -34, Racha-Lechkhumi and Kvemo Svaneti -3.
